Requirements
- 12+ years of total professional experience, including 7–10+ years in product management roles within high-growth environments.
- Strong background in fintech, financial services, challenger banking, or similarly regulated industries is highly preferred.
- Proven ability to define product strategy, drive execution, and deliver measurable business impact in complex environments.
- Strong customer-centric mindset with a focus on improving financial health and user outcomes.
-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ills with experience in data-driven decision-making, experimentation, and KPI ownership.
- Strong communication and stakeholder management skills with experience aligning diverse cross-functional teams.
- Hands-on experience working with omni-channel communication systems is highly desirable.
- Familiarity with SQL, regulatory product environments, or global/multi-market teams is a plus.
- Strong execution mindset with the ability to remove blockers and drive delivery in fast-moving environments.
Responsibilities
- Define and own product strategy, roadmap, and OKRs for customer communication products within the lending and financial services domain.
- Lead cross-functional execution with engineering, design, ML, analytics, and business teams to deliver scalable and impactful product solutions.
- Develop deep customer understanding through research, feedback loops, and data analysis to continuously improve user experience and outcomes.
- Drive data-informed decision-making using experimentation, metrics tracking, and performance analysis to optimize product KPIs.
- Lead the development and launch of new communication features across omni-channel platforms including SMS, email, push, voice, and letter.
- Collaborate closely with compliance, legal, and risk teams to ensure products meet regulatory and industry standards.
- Own financial planning aspects including budgeting, forecasting, and tracking product performance against business goals.
- Communicate product vision, progress, and priorities clearly to executives and cross-functional stakeholders.
